EDITORS COMMENTS
Cornelis Bega's painting, "A Sick Peasant Woman," dates back to the Baroque era of the 17th century. The Dutch artist masterfully captured the essence of rural life during this period, focusing on the daily struggles and realities of agricultural laborers. In this poignant work, we see a peasant woman lying indoors, her face etched with the signs of illness and fatigue. Her worn, simple clothing and the earthenware pottery in the background serve as reminders of her humble profession as a farm laborer or farmhand. The muted colors and dim interior further emphasize the somber mood, while the man, possibly her husband or caretaker, looks on with a concerned expression. This painting offers a glimpse into the lives of the Danish and Dutch peasants during the agricultural age, providing a poignant reminder of the hardships and resilience of rural communities in the Low Countries. The National Gallery of Denmark, also known as Statens Museum for Kunst, proudly houses this significant piece of heritage art, which continues to captivate and inspire viewers with its raw, emotional power.
